What You’ll Be Doing Assisting with the preparation and service of nutritious, well‑presented meals. Ensuring all health, safety, and hygiene standards are followed to the highest level. Helping minimise waste and using kitchen equipment safely and efficiently. Supporting the catering team and communicating any issues promptly. What You’ll Bring Level 2 Food Safety Certificate (or willingness to obtain one). Knowledge of Health & Safety and COSHH procedures. Previous experience in a catering or kitchen environment. Experience working with older people (ideal, but not essential). What Makes You a Great Fit Strong organisational skills and the ability to prioritise when things get busy. Calm, professional, and able to work well under pressure. A true team player who’s also confident working independently. Reliable, adaptable, and committed to delivering high standards every day.
